溫馨提示×

hbase createtable時如何設置列族

小樊
102
2024-12-21 10:50:47
欄目: 大數據

在HBase中,創建表時需要指定列族(Column Family)。列族是HBase表中存儲數據的結構,它們具有相同的屬性和存儲需求。要設置列族,請在創建表時使用CREATE TABLE命令,并在命令中指定列族名稱和相關的列限定符。

以下是一個創建表的示例,其中包含一個名為cf1的列族:

create 'my_table', 'cf1'

如果您希望為表添加多個列族,可以這樣做:

create 'my_table', {NAME => 'cf1', VERSIONS => 3}, {NAME => 'cf2', VERSIONS => 5}

在這個例子中,我們創建了一個名為my_table的表,并定義了兩個列族:cf1cf2。cf1的版本數為3,而cf2的版本數為5。

請注意,列族的名稱在HBase中必須是唯一的,且區分大小寫。另外,列族的屬性可以在創建表時設置,也可以在表創建后使用ALTER TABLE命令進行修改。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女